fann_set_activation_function
(PECL fann >= 1.0.0)
fann_set_activation_function — Establece la función de activación para la neurona y capa proporcionadas
Descripción
$ann
, int $activation_function
, int $layer
, int $neuron
)Establece la función de activación para la neurona número neuron en la capa número layer, contando al capa de entrada como capa 0.
No es posible establecer funciones de activación para las neuronas de la capa de entrada.
Al elegir una función de activación, es importante observar que las funciones de activación tienen un rango diferente.
FANN_SIGMOID está, p.ej., en el rango 0 - 1, mientras que FANN_SIGMOID_SYMMETRIC está
en el rango -1 - 1, y FANN_LINEAR no tiene límites.
The supplied activation_function value must be one of the activation functions constants.
El valor devuelto es una de las constantes de funciones de activación.
Parámetros
-
ann -
Un resource de red neuronal.
-
activation_function -
La constante de funciones de activación.
-
layer -
El número de capa.
-
neuron -
El número de neurona.
Valores devueltos
Devuelve TRUE en caso de éxito, o FALSE de lo contrario.
Ver también
- fann_set_activation_function_layer() - Establece la función de activación para todas las neuronas de la capa proporcionada
- fann_set_activation_function_hidden() - Establece la función de activación para todas las capas ocultas
- fann_set_activation_function_output() - Establece la función de activación para la capa de salida
- fann_set_activation_steepness() - Establece la pendiente de activación el número de neurona y capa proporcionados
- fann_get_activation_function() - Devuelve la función de activación